Hagerty Total Stockholder Equity yearly trend continues to be fairly stable with very little volatility. Total Stockholder Equity is likely to outpace its year average in 2025. Total Stockholder Equity is the total equity held by shareholders, calculated as the difference between a company's total assets and total liabilities. It represents the net value of the company owned by shareholders. View All Fundamentals

Hagerty Total Stockholder Equity History

2025212 M
2024201.9 M
2023175.5 M
202259.3 M
2021-323.8 M
2020117.2 M
